Foundry-Constructor Layout

Foundry design pattern for processing metal alloys, with constructor floors underneath. This particular blueprint is configured to produce copper metal alloy and copper sheets. The building is made to be easily copied and reused. Each building comprises of: 10 foundries on the roof; 2 or 3 floors of 15 constructors

Tutorial:Main bus

This is a good measure to combat "spaghetti factories" as it forces someone to plan a structured layout and move everything to use items from the bus. This is also a downside as there are more belts used and therefore more room for belt-buffer and everything is less compact. ... copper and steel, and then over time and distance gains more and ...
